Market Context

CapFed has seen modest upward movement in recent sessions, trading near the $7.71 level with a +1.70% gain. The stock recently tested support around $7.32 before bouncing, and it now faces resistance near $8.10. Volume patterns have been relatively subdued, suggesting that the recent advance lacks aggressive accumulation but also indicating limited selling pressure at current levels. In the broader regional banking sector, sentiment has been mixed, with some peers benefiting from a flattening yield curve while others face margin compression. CapFed's positioning as a community-focused lender may offer relative stability compared to larger peers, particularly in its core markets. The stock's price action appears to be influenced by general sector rotation rather than company-specific catalysts, as no major recent earnings reports have provided fresh fundamental direction. Market participants are likely monitoring upcoming economic data for clues on interest rate policy, which could affect net interest margins across the industry. While CapFed's share price has stabilized above its recent lows, the lack of strong volume support suggests that a decisive breakout above resistance may require a broader sector tailwind or a positive catalyst. For now, the stock remains in a range-bound pattern, with traders watching for either a push through $8.10 or a retest of the $7.32 support zone. Technical Analysis

CapFed (CFFN) is currently trading near $7.71, positioned between established support at $7.32 and resistance at $8.10. Recent price action suggests a period of consolidation, with the stock oscillating within this range over the past several sessions. The support level near $7.32 has held firm on multiple touches, indicating that buyers are stepping in at that zone, while resistance around $8.10 has capped upside attempts, reflecting seller congestion. From a trend perspective, the stock appears to be in a broad sideways pattern on the daily chart, lacking a clear directional bias. Short-term moving averages are converging, which could signal a breakout or breakdown in the coming weeks. Volume has been relatively subdued during this consolidation, suggesting that market participants are waiting for a catalyst. Technical indicators are displaying mixed signals. Momentum oscillators hover in neutral territory, neither overbought nor oversold, implying that the stock may be coiling for a more pronounced move. A close above $8.10 could open the door to further upside, while a break below $7.32 might invite renewed selling pressure. Traders may watch for volume confirmation to gauge the strength of any directional shift.
